Actress Renée Rapp will leave The Sex Lives of College Girls in the third season

Things are changing at Essex College. One of the cast members will leave the series next season.
Renée Rapp leaves Max series The Sex Lives of College Girls. Rapp stars as Leighton, a wealthy New York freshman trying to live up to her mother's high expectations. It was her television debut.



Deadline understands that Rapp (pictured) will appear in a handful of episodes of season three of the series, which was renewed in December, but will no longer have a regular role in the series and will leave the series after those episodes.

The Sex Lives of College Girls follows four roommates during their freshman year at New England's prestigious Essex College. Season two continues with the students returning from their fall break and tackling the challenges they encountered at the end of the first season, while also facing their next semester filled with new faces, parties, and predicaments.

Mindy Kaling and Justin Noble's series is one of the streamer's highest-performing originals.

The series also stars Pauline Chalamet, Amrit Kaur, Alyah Chanelle Scott, Mekki Leeper, Christopher Meyer, Ilia Isorelýs Paulino, Lolo Spencer, Renika Williams and Mitchell Slaggert.

Rapp, who signed with WME last November, also has a growing music career. Last year, she signed with Interscope Records and released her debut EP, Everything to Everyone. She also made her Broadway debut in Mean Girls as Regina George in 2019.
